1. Under Appointment scheduled, more details on a project can be added by clicking to the “Detail” from Project Details.
For example, the Measurement, Installation, Delivery, Others and measurement. User can select the job type from the drop down list, input name, remarks.
User can also take photo or video from mobile and upload media from the phone to attach to the job details. If mobile Apps is used, the media can be uploaded from the Apps and automatically sychronised to the details of the Appointment.


The client basic details will be displayed under Project Information.
User can click “+Add Detail” to add measurement, installation, delivery, others details for the specific appointment.

User can add details based on the Job Type such as Installation, Delivery, Others and Measurement.

Measurement comes with Name, Note 1, Note 2, Note 3, Size, Remarks and Photos/Videos.

Installation, Delivery and Others come with Name, Remarks and Photos/Videos only.

Appt ID - A unique Appointment ID will be assigned and displayed above the table for every appointment. The appointment ID can be used to share media with another Kakaral user and automatically append in their Kakaral account and project.
Information entered by contractor through the Apps will also automatically appear in the Product Requirements table.

User can click “Edit” to edit the Project Requirements

Edit the details and click “Update”

Under Action, user can click the the ellipsis "⋮" to;
· View /Delete a Project Requirements related to the job.

When medias are attached in the respective job types (Installation, Delivery, Others and Measurement), it will be added into Media. The media count indicates the total number of medias for that particular Appointment ID.
Media

User can select and share the media with another Appointment ID or another Kakaral User by inputting their Appointment ID.

User can enter Appointment ID obtained via the Project Information page or in the Appointment email of the Person in Charge (PIC).
